Discord Expands Nitro Membership With New Rewards and Gaming Partnerships

According to a recent LinkedIn post from Discord, the company is introducing Nitro Rewards as an added feature within its existing Nitro membership at no additional cost. The post highlights that the initiative aims to expand Nitro from a communication-focused upgrade into a broader gaming-lifestyle membership.

The company’s LinkedIn post indicates that initial partners include Xbox Game Pass, Logitech G, and SteelSeries, with more brands expected. The post describes benefits such as access to more than 50 games, limited monthly cloud gaming, annual Xbox Store rewards, hardware discounts, and enhanced Orbs rewards for in-app engagement.

For investors, the post suggests Discord is pursuing a strategy to deepen user monetization and retention by bundling third-party value into Nitro rather than raising prices. This could support recurring revenue growth if the richer value proposition drives higher Nitro adoption and reduces churn.

The emphasis on partnerships with major gaming and hardware brands may signal a broader ecosystem strategy that positions Discord as a central hub for gaming services and commerce. If successful, this approach could strengthen the platform’s competitive moat against other communication and gaming services by differentiating its subscription offering.

The rewards structure, including Orbs multipliers tied to quests, points to increased gamification and engagement mechanics within Discord’s product. Higher engagement could translate into better cross-selling opportunities, more attractive data for partners, and potential leverage in future commercial agreements.

However, the post does not address the cost structure or revenue-sharing terms associated with Nitro Rewards, leaving uncertainty around near-term margin impact. Investors may want to monitor whether the expanded benefits materially increase subscriber numbers and average revenue per user over time, as well as how sustainably Discord can maintain such incentives.
